I don't ever use "yesterday night" the contrast between "day" and "night" might cause a bit of confusion for native speakers because of the cognitive dissonance (might sound like you're trying to say it's day and night at the same time). There is a replacement for this "yesternight" but I think it's more archaic and not in use in modern English.
